The Easiest Baked Garlic & Herb Salmon Recipe Ever! 🏆 Ingredients: 1 whole salmon filet (approx. 3 lb) or steelhead trout 1/2 cup olive oil 4 garlic cloves, minced 1/2 tsp dried thyme 1/2 tsp oregano 1/2 tsp onion powder 1/2 tsp cayenne pepper 1–2 tsp salt (plus a pinch more after baking if needed) 1 tsp black pepper 1 tbsp lemon juice + 8 lemon slices (or enough to cover the bottom of the fish) 4 sprigs rosemary (optional) Instructions: Preheat your oven to 400°F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Lay lemon slices down and place the salmon, flesh side up, on top. In a small bowl, mix the olive oil with all the seasonings, then pour the mixture evenly over the salmon. Squeeze lemon juice over the top and add rosemary sprigs if using. Bake uncovered for about 30 minutes, or until the salmon flakes easily and reaches an internal temp of 145°F. #salmon #seafood #food #EasyRecipe #dinner #Foodie #foodtiktok

This lemon pasta is so good, you’ll be making it all summer! 🍋🤤 Ingredients: 10-12 oz of Spaghetti Pasta (a little more than half of a 1lb box) 6 Garlic Cloves (minced) 1-2 Tbsp of Freshly Chopped Parsley Lemon Zest (from 1 lemon) Lemon Juice (from 2 lemons) 1 Tbsp Crushed Red Pepper Flakes (or preferred amount) 3 Tbsp Unsalted Butter 1/4 cup Extra Virgin Olive Oil (plus a little extra to add to the pan with the garlic red pepper flakes) 2/3 cup of Grated Pecorino Romano or Parmesan Cheese (plus a little extra to add at the end) Instructions: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the spaghetti and cook according to the package instructions until al dente. In a medium to large mixing bowl, add the lemon juice, olive oil, cheese, and lemon zest. Mix until fully incorporated. If it becomes too thick, add a bit more olive oil. If it becomes too thin, add a little more cheese and mix well. In a large skillet, heat about 3 tablespoons of extra virgin olive oil over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té until fragrant and lightly golden, about 1-2 minutes. Add the crushed red pepper flakes and cook for another 30 seconds to infuse the garlic and red pepper flakes. Turn the heat down to the lowest setting and add the butter, stirring until it melts. Turn off the heat and immediately add the pasta to the skillet straight from the pot. Add the lemon/cheese/olive oil mixture, then add 1/4 cup of the reserved pasta water. Mix well until everything is incorporated. Add the chopped parsley and mix until incorporated. Add more cheese if desired for a creamier pasta. Serve immediately. #pasta #pastalover #lemon #food #Foodie #foodies #foodtiktok #FoodLover #EasyRecipes

This smoked maple bourbon BBQ sauce might be better than your grandma’s Sunday dinner — and yes, I said what I said. 🤤🔥🔥 Smoked Maple Bourbon BBQ Sauce (Makes 3 Cups) Ingredients: 2 cups ketchup ⅔ cup bourbon ⅔ cup apple cider (or apple juice) 6 Tbsp apple cider vinegar ½ cup dark molasses 6 Tbsp pure maple syrup 2 Tbsp Worcestershire sauce 1 tsp smoked paprika 1 tsp garlic powder 1 tsp onion powder 1 tsp kosher salt ½ tsp black pepper Directions: After blending everything together, pour the BBQ sauce into a heatproof dish and smoke it at 225 degrees for about 45–50 minutes. This gives it that deep, smoky flavor that sets it apart. Let it cool completely, then transfer it to a sealed jar or container. You can store it in the fridge for up to a month — if it lasts that long. #bbq #bbqsauce #sauce #maple #food #Foodie #foodiec#EasyRecipesg #foodtiktok

This ain’t breakfast—this is therapy on a plate. 🔥🤤 Smoked Gouda Grits Ingredients: 2 cups Chicken Stock (or broth) 2 cups Water 1 cup Stone-Ground White or Yellow Grits (not polenta or instant grits) 1 1/2 cup Smoked Gouda Cheese (shredded) 1 Stick Unsalted Butter 1/4 cup Heavy Cream Salt to Taste Instructions: In a large saucepan, bring 2 cups of chicken stock and 2 cups of water to a boil. Optionally, add a pinch of salt to the chicken stock water. This is optional, as the chicken stock contains some salt. Stir in 1 cup of grits, and immediately reduce the heat to the lowest setting. Continue stirring to prevent lumps. Allow the grits to simmer, stirring occasionally, until they start to thicken up. This may take about 10-15 minutes. Once the grits have thickened, add one stick of unsalted butter and 1/4 cup of heavy cream. Stir continuously until the mixture thickens further and becomes creamy. Gradually add the smoked Gouda cheese to the grits and continue stirring until the cheese is fully melted and the grits are rich and creamy. Taste the grits and season with salt as needed. Remember that the cheese adds some saltiness, so be careful not to oversalt. Cook the grits for a couple more minutes to ensure everything is well combined and heated through. Remove the saucepan from heat and serve the creamy Southern grits immediately. #cheese #food #foodies #foodlovers #cooking #delicious #Foodie #grits #foodtiktok

Ingredients: 1 can condensed French onion soup 2 cans beef consommé 2 c white rice 1 stick unsalted butter, cut into pieces 8 oz baby bella mushrooms, chopped 1 c grated Pecorino Romano or Parmesan 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s or cutlets 2 tsp kosher salt 1 tsp black pepper 1 tsp each: garlic powder, onion powder, paprika 1 tbsp chopped parsley (optional) Directions: Preheat oven to 350 In a 9x13” baking dish, mix rice, French onion soup, consommé, and mushrooms. Sprinkle in ¾ cup of cheese and dot the top with butter. Season chicken thighs with sal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, and paprika. Lay them over the rice mixture and top with the remaining cheese. Cover tightly with foil. Bake for 45 minutes. Remove foil and continue baking another 20 minutes, or until the rice is tender and the chicken is fully cooked with golden edges. Garnish with parsley if using. #chicken #chickenrecipes #rice #food #foodies #Foodie #EasyRecipe #foodtiktok

Seattle teriyaki’s signature method was born in ’76 when Chef Toshi cut chicken into bite-sized pieces, marinating them overnight in a simple blend of soy sauce, brown sugar, fresh ginger & garlic. Skewered and seared over hot coals, each turn locked in a sweet-salty caramelized glaze that became our city’s culinary calling card. From those first sticks at Toshi’s to every backyard grill, this fast-cook, high-heat technique is how Seattle learned to teriyaki. 🔥🍢 Teriyaki Sauce (Yields about 1 cup of Teriyaki sauce/Double the ingredients for more) 3/4 Cup Soy Sauce 1/2 Cup Mirin 1/2 Cup Sake 1 Tbsp Sesame Oil 1/2 Cup Brown Sugar 8 Garlic Cloves (minced) 1/4 Cup Ginger Root (sliced into coins or minced) Cornstarch slurry: 1 Tbsp Corn Starch & 3 Tbsp of water. On medium heat, in a large pan or pot, add all of the sauce ingredients except for the cornstarch slurry and stir. Whisk the slurry thoroughly in a separate bowl, add to sauce and whisk until completely combined. Bring to a boil then simmer on low heat, covered for 15 minutes stirring occasionally until it starts to thicken up. Strain out garlic and ginger and pour in a mason jar. If you are using this to marinate meat, please let the sauce cool completely before adding it. If the sauce is too thick, add a little water as needed and whisk again until you get your desired consistency. #teriyaki #sauce #seattle #food #foodies #EasyRecipes #cooking #foodporn #foodtiktok

Ingredients: 1 lb dried fettuccine 1 stick unsalted butter 1 shallot, minced 1 cup heavy cream 3.5 cups finely grated Parmigiano-Reggiano 1 tsp salt (to taste) 1 tsp freshly ground black pepper (to taste) Chopped fresh parsley, for garnish (optional) Instructions: Cook fettuccine in salted boiling water until al dente. Reserve 1/4 cup of the pasta water, then drain. Meanwhile, melt butter in a saucepan over medium heat. Sauté shallots until soft, then stir in cream, bring to a quick boil then reduce the heat to low and simmer for 5 minutes until slightly reduced. Add 3/4 of the drained pasta to the pan with the cream sauce over medium heat. Add the reserved pasta water, and half the Parmigiano-Reggiano. Toss until creamy and well coated. Season with salt and pepper. Turn the heat off. Add in the remaining cheese & parsley and mix until incorporated. Serve immediately. Tip: Add the remaining cheese as needed or to liking. #pasta #pastalover #food #foodies #foodstagram #EasyRecipes #cooking #foodtiktok
Salty meets sweet in one epic bark 🥔🍫 It’s called “bark” because its jagged shards mimic rugged tree bark. Chocolate bark traces back to 13th-century French mendiants, and peppermint bark first appeared in the U.S. around 1966. Potato Chip Bark with Peanut Butter Drizzle Ingredients 48 oz real milk chocolate chips 2 bags ridged (wavy) potato chips 1 cup creamy peanut butter Equipment: Large rimmed baking sheet Parchment paper Medium saucepan and heatproof bowl (for double boiler) Microwave-safe bowl Offset spatula or spoon Sharp knife or pizza cutter Latex gloves Method: Line the baking sheet with parchment paper and evenly scatter the potato chips across its surface in a single layer. Fill the saucepan with 1–2 inches of water and bring to a gentle simmer. Nest the heatproof bowl on top, ensuring it doesn’t touch the water. Add the chocolate chips and stir occasionally until completely melted and glossy. Carefully pour the melted chocolate over the chips. Using clean hands (or wear gloves), gently mix and incorporate the chips and melted chocolate until every chip is coated. In the microwave-safe bowl, heat the peanut butter on High for 30 seconds. Stir, then heat an additional 15–30 seconds if needed until pourable. Drizzle the warm peanut butter over the chocolate-coated chips in a zig-zag pattern. Allow the bark to sit at room temperature until fully set, about 1 hour. Use the sharp knife to cut the bark into squares. For extra snap and creaminess, transfer the squares to a container and refrigerate for 30 minutes before serving. #foodtiktok #peanutbutter #chocolate #EasyRecipe #food #Foodie #cooking #Recipe #recipes

A problem I’ll never fix. 🫐🍊🔥 Blueberry Orange Butter Swim Biscuits Inspo: @Grandbabycakes Blueberry Jam 1½ c fresh blueberries 1½ Tbsp sugar 1 tsp orange juice ¼ tsp orange zest Pinch kosher salt Biscuits 2½ c all-purpose flour 2 tsp salt 4 tsp baking powder 1 Tbsp sugar 2 c full-fat buttermilk (room temp) 1 tsp orange extract ¾ tsp orange zest 1 c fresh blueberries 1 stick unsalted butter Orange Glaze 1 c powdered sugar 1 tsp orange zest 1 tsp orange juice 1–2 Tbsp milk Instructions In a small saucepan over medium-low heat, cook the blueberries, sugar, juice, zest, and salt until thickened, about 7 min. Let cool. Preheat oven to 450°F and move rack to the lower third. Place butter in a 9x9 dish and melt in the oven, about 5 min. In a large bowl, mix flour, salt, baking powder, and sugar. Add buttermilk, orange extract, and zest. Stir until just combined, then fold in blueberries. Drop in half the jam and give it a couple gentle folds for a swirl effect. Pour the batter into the hot buttered dish and spread evenly. Dot the top with the rest of the jam and lightly swirl with a knife. Score into 9 squares. Bake for 25 min or until tops are golden and edges are bubbling. Cover loosely with foil if browning too quickly. Let cool for 5 min. Mix glaze ingredients and drizzle over warm biscuits. Slice and serve. #biscuits #biscuit #blueberry #blueberries #food #foodies #cooking #baking #foodtiktok

Ingredients: 1 cup dried egg whites (about 80g) 1 cup water 1 cup whipped cottage cheese (about 230g) Instructions: Preheat the oven to 350°F. Blend the cottage cheese until smooth and chill it in the fridge. Add dried egg whites and water to a bowl and blend (hand mixer or stand mixer works best) until stiff peaks form—this may take several minutes, so don’t stop early! Once peaks are firm, gently fold in the whipped cottage cheese. Don’t stir—just fold carefully to keep the volume. Transfer the mixture to a lined and greased loaf pan. Bake for 35–40 minutes, or until the top is golden and the center is fully set. Let it cool completely before slicing. #eggs #egg #bread #lowcarb #food #Foodie #EasyRecipes #cooking #foodtiktok
